August 21 2005 – Ryan Church doubled and singled in a six-run first inning, and the Washington Nationals (66-59) went on to beat the New York Mets (63-61) 7-4. August 18 2005 – Washington erased a four-run deficit and the bullpen did the rest. Carlos Baerga’s go-ahead single in the eighth inning gave the Washington Nationals (64-57) a 5-4 victory and a split of doubleheader with the Philadelphia Phillies (65-57).
